When it comes to making a burrito, we never seem to get the folding right. But now, one person on TikTok has revealed the correct way to fold the tortilla - and it's so easy.

Why have we never done it this way before?! You can watch the clip below:

"I was today years old when I learned how to properly fold a burrito," the user, who goes by @f0hnzie on TikTok, explained.

"You fold the sides twice to pinch the ends, it's a hexagon, not a rectangle."

The TikToker can be seen adding plenty of filling to the wrap, before pinching both sides inwards and rolling into a hexagon shape.

Other users were loving the technique in the comments, with some sharing their own tips and tricks about how to make the perfect burrito.

One person commented: "And if you warm it up a bit before, it will be stretchy and won't rip if there are a lot of toppings!"

Genius.

Others begged to know the recipe, which the user explained was a combo' of grilled chicken, stir fry, cheese, avocado, cilantro, lime and guacamole salsa.

In other TikTok news, did you know there's a correct way to fold a fajita too?

One TikTok user, known as @thefoldinglady, explained she'd been taught how to fold the wrap by fellow user @mealswithmax.

She begins by placing the wrap down and adding the filling, spaced out evenly across the tortilla. Next, she folds both sides of the wrap inwards before rolling from the bottom which creates a neat, rectangular shape.

The wrap can then be cut in half and voila! The perfect fajita with no spillages! And it stays in place.
